BBQ CHICKEN PIZZA WITH FETA



BBQ Chicken Pizza With Feta image

From Kraft Foods, the combination of onion, bbq sauce and feta is so yummy with the cheese! For this recipe I use Recipe #35805 for the pizza crust!

Provided by SarahBeth

Categories     Lunch/Snacks

Time 32m

Yield 1 pizza, 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 6

1 prepared pizza crust (12 inch)
1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ese, divided
1 cup grilled chicken breast, coarsely chopped
1/4 cup prepared barbecue sauce
1 (4 ounce) package crumbled feta cheese
1 small red onion, halved, thinly sliced and separated into rings

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 450°F
  • Place pizza crust on ungreased baking sheet and sprinkle with 1/2 cup of the mozzarella cheese.
  • Toss chicken with barbecue sauce; spoon evenly onto crust.
  • Top with feta cheese, onions and the remaining 1/2 cup mozzarella cheese.
  • BAKE 10 to 12 minute or until cheese is melted and crust is golden brown.
  • Let stand 5 minute before cutting to serve.

ALMOST-FAMOUS BARBECUE CHICKEN PIZZA



Almost-Famous Barbecue Chicken Pizza image

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Time 1h30m

Yield one 10-inch pizza

Number Of Ingredients 9

1 teaspoon extra-virgin olive oil, plus more for brushing
1/2 pound prepared pizza dough, at room temperature
1/3 cup plus 2 tablespoons dark barbecue sauce
1 8-ounce skinless, boneless chicken breast
Kosher salt and freshly ground pepper
2/3 cup grated smoked gouda cheese (about 3 ounces)
2/3 cup grated part-skim mozzarella cheese (about 3 ounces)
1/2 small red onion, thinly sliced
Fresh cilantro, for topping

Steps:

  • Brush a large bowl with olive oil. Shape the pizza dough into a ball, add it to the bowl and turn to coat with the oil. Cover tightly with plastic wrap and set aside in a warm place, 30 to 40 minutes.
  • Position racks in the upper third and middle of the oven. Place a pizza stone or inverted baking sheet on the top rack and preheat the oven to 425 degrees F for at least 30 minutes.
  • Meanwhile, lay out a sheet of parchment paper and brush with olive oil. Transfer the ball of dough to the parchment and roll it out into a 10-inch round, stretching it with your hands as needed. Lightly brush the dough with olive oil, cover with another piece of parchment and set aside to let rise slightly, about 30 minutes.
  • While the dough rises, mix 2 tablespoons barbecue sauce and 1 teaspoon olive oil in a small bowl. Put the chicken in a baking dish, season with salt and pepper and brush with the barbecue sauce mixture. Bake on the middle oven rack until cooked through, about 20 minutes. Let cool, then cut into 1/2-inch cubes.
  • Uncover the dough and spread with the remaining 1/3 cup barbecue sauce, leaving a 3/4-inch border. Top with the chicken, gouda, mozzarella and red onion. Slide the pizza (on the parchment) onto a pizza peel or another inverted baking sheet, then slide onto the hot stone or baking sheet; bake until the cheese melts and the crust is golden, 20 to 25 minutes. Sprinkle with cilantro.

BARBECUE CHICKEN PIZZA



Barbecue Chicken Pizza image

This simple recipe celebrates a 1980s classic invented by the American pizza genius Ed LaDou (whose fingerprints are also on Wolfgang Puck's famous smoked-salmon pizza). The pizza matches the flavors of chicken with barbecue sauce, red onion, two kinds of cheese and a little cilantro. Use homemade dough and barbecue sauce, cook it in the hottest setting of your oven, and the classic pie goes from good to great. Want to make the recipe vegetarian? Simply substitute mushrooms for the chicken and sauté until most of their moisture is evaporated.

Provided by Tejal Rao

Categories     pizza and calzones, main course

Time 30m

Yield 2 12-inch pizzas

Number Of Ingredients 9

10 ounces chicken breast or boneless, skinless thighs, cut into 1-inch pieces
1 teaspoon kosher salt
3 tablespoons olive oil
1/4 cup plus 2 tablespoons barbecue sauce
2 17-ounce balls pizza dough (see recipe)
8 ounces fresh mozzarella, roughly sliced
1/2 red onion, cut into 1/4-inch slices
2 ounces Gouda, roughly grated
A few sprigs fresh cilantro, for garnish

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 500. Season the chicken with salt, and heat 1 tablespoon of oil in a saucepan over medium heat. Toss the chicken into hot oil, and cook for about 5 minutes, shaking the pan occasionally, until you no longer see any pink. Add 2 tablespoons of barbecue sauce, and stir well, then set aside off the heat.
  • Working on two separate pieces of parchment paper, use your hands to stretch the 2 balls of dough into 2 rough circles, about 12 inches in diameter. Slide each piece of parchment paper onto a baking tray, and finish assembling pizza there: Drizzle with remaining olive oil, spread with remaining barbecue sauce, then evenly divide the mozzarella all over. Top with chicken pieces, red onion and finally Gouda.
  • Bake for 15 minutes, or until dough is cooked through and edges of the onion and cheese are just starting to color. Once the pizza is slightly cooled, season with salt and pepper and scatter with cilantro.

BARBECUE CHICKEN PIZZA



Barbecue Chicken Pizza image

My husband and I love this BBQ chicken pizza recipe, especially when we take it up a notch by adding other toppings that we love, including smoky bacon and creamy Gorgonzola. My mouth starts to water just thinking about it! -Megan Crow, Lincoln, Nebraska

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Dinner

Time 45m

Yield 8 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 11

2 tablespoons olive oil
1 medium red onion, sliced
1 tube (13.8 ounces) refrigerated pizza crust
3/4 cup barbecue sauce
2 cups shredded cooked chicken breast
6 bacon strips, cooked and crumbled
1/4 cup crumbled Gorgonzola cheese
2 jalapeno peppers, seeded and minced
1 teaspoon paprika
1 teaspoon garlic powder
2 cups shredded part-skim mozzarella cheese

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 425°. In a large skillet, heat oil over medium heat. Add onion; cook and stir 4-6 minutes or until softened. Reduce heat to medium-low; cook 20-25 minutes or until deep golden brown, stirring occasionally., Unroll and press dough onto bottom and 1/2 in. up sides of a greased 15x10x1-in. baking pan. Bake 8 minutes., Spread barbecue sauce over dough; top with chicken, cooked onion, bacon, Gorgonzola cheese and jalapenos. Sprinkle with paprika and garlic powder; top with mozzarella cheese. Bake pizza 8-10 minutes or until crust is golden and cheese is melted. Freeze option: Bake pizza crust as directed; cool. Top with all the ingredients as directed, and securely wrap and freeze unbaked pizza. To use, unwrap pizza; bake as directed, increasing time as necessary.

GRILLED PIZZA WITH GRILLED RED ONIONS AND FETA



Grilled Pizza With Grilled Red Onions and Feta image

I use a perforated grill pan to cook sliced onions and other vegetables on the grill. They'll have a nice charred flavor and be just soft enough if you cook them before you put them on the pizza.

Provided by Martha Rose Shulman

Categories     pizza and calzones, main course

Time 30m

Yield 3 10-inch pizzas

Number Of Ingredients 7

2 to 3 medium red onions, cut in half lengthwise and thinly sliced across the grain
Extra virgin olive oil
Salt and freshly ground pepper
3 10-inch pizza crusts (1 recipe)
3/4 cup marinara sauce made with fresh or canned tomatoes
1 tablespoon (or more, to taste) fresh thyme leaves
3 ounces crumbled feta

Steps:

  • Prepare a hot grill. Place the onions in a bowl and toss with 1 tablespoon of the olive oil and salt and pepper to taste. Place a perforated grill pan on the grill and let it get hot, then add the onions and cook, tossing in the pan or stirring with tongs, for about 3 to 5 minutes, just until they soften slightly and begin to char. Remove from the grill and return the onions to the bowl.
  • Oil the hot grill rack with olive oil, either by brushing with a grill brush or by dipping a folded wad of paper towels in olive oil and using tongs to rub the rack with it. Place a round of dough on a lightly dusted baker's peel or rimless baking sheet. Slide the pizza dough from the peel or baking sheet onto the grill rack. If the dough has just come from the freezer and is easy to handle, you can just place it on the rack without bothering with the peel. Close the lid of the grill - the vents should be closed --- and set the timer for 2 minutes.
  • Lift up the grill lid. The surface of the dough should display some big air bubbles. Using tongs, lift the dough to see if it is evenly browning on the bottom. Rotate the dough to assure even browning. Keep it on the grill, moving it around as necessary, until it is nicely browned, with grill marks. Watch closely so that it doesn't burn. When it is nicely browned on the bottom (it may be blackened in spots), use tongs or a spatula to slide the dough onto the baking sheet or peel, and remove from the grill. Cover the grill again.
  • Make sure that there is still some flour on the peel or baking sheet and flip the dough over so that the uncooked side is now on the bottom. Brush the top lightly with oil, then top with a thin layer of tomato sauce (no more than 1/4¼ cup) and a layer of grilled sliced onions. Sprinkle with thyme and feta, and drizzle on a little more olive oil. Slide the pizza back onto the grill. If using a gas grill, reduce the heat to medium-high. Close the lid and cook for 2 to 3 more minutes, until the bottom is brown. Open the grill and check the pizza. The top should be hot and the bottom nicely browned. If the bottom is getting too dark but the pizza still needs a little more time, move it to a cooler part of the grill and close the top. Use a spatula or tongs to remove the pizza to a cutting board. Cut into wedges and serve. Repeat with the other two crusts.
